Purchased from Capitol Volkswagen in San Jose, CA in July 2018. Was purchased as a Certified Pre-owned (CPO) vehicle and came with CPO warranty that expired at 50k miles. This vehicle was recalled and modified by Volkswagen of America as part of the TDI Emissions fix and was resold as a CPO vehicle. There is an Extended Emissions Warranty that runs for 10 years and 6 months or 126,000 miles from the modification/fix date of 05/22/2018 and 32,186 miles. I used this car for my 90 mile commute, 5 days a week, and it’s been nearly flawless. I would routinely get an average of 32 to 35 mpg at 70-75 mph freeway speeds. If cruising at 60-65 you can easily see nearly 40 mpg. 
The six speed manual transmission shifts well and has no issues. Also includes a weighted shift knob for better shift feel. Clutch feels good and grabs well. No slipping or chattering.
The interior is in nearly perfect condition. There are no rips or tears in any of the leather seats, carpets, headliner or door panels. Some minor stains on light colored headliner, but nothing a steam cleaning couldn’t fix. An aftermarket wireless charger was also installed in the center console and a VW cargo mat in the trunk.
The only major issue on the interior is a common problem with the panoramic roof shade. It has come unglued from the track that it moves on and sags down if opened. I was able to open the shade completely and have left it as is. I purchased a HeatShield brand reflector shade for the roof and windshield to help keep the heat down without the original sunshade working.
The exterior is in good condition, but the paint is not perfect, however, so I will list any major issues (please see photos as well). As the mileage is mostly freeway driving, the front end has the typical rock chips and damage from debris. The front bumper is the worst and paint has flaked off in a few places. Being street parked frequently caused a few scratches as well. The rear bumper was hit at some point when I was parked and it left some scratches. There are no major dents or body damage, but every panel has at least some kind of small scratches or scuff marks from normal everyday use. I love this car but the paint was not taken care of; I just didn’t have the time.

Here is some info on maintenance and repairs done during my ownership:
- Oil changes have been done every 10k miles and diesel fuel filters replaced every other oil change (20k miles) as per VW’s maintenance schedule. https://pics.tdiclub.com/data/516/2013_Jetta_TDI.pdf
- The OEM Continental tires were replaced in 2019 with Goodyear Eagle Sport tires at America’s Tire in Napa, CA.
- Brake pads and rotors were replaced by me in summer of 2019
- Brake fluid flushed with new DOT 4 fluid when replacing brake components
- Sunroof drains were clogged shortly after buying the car and it did leak into the vehicle during heavy rain, but luckily only once. The spare tire well was collecting water and the front carpets were wet. I had this cleaned and fixed properly by removing the entire carpets from the vehicle, drying over the course of a week in the dry california heat and with large space heaters. All wet fabrics were treated with anti-odor and anti-mold sprays and reinstalled. I haven’t noticed any other leaks since having the drains cleared and re installed correctly, but it is probably time to have the drains cleaned again and the sunroof rails lubricated.
- Liftgate gas struts were replaced with ECS Tuning "Hatch Pop Kit" which includes strong gas struts with a spring to open liftgate handsfree. https://www.ecstuning.com/b-ecs-parts/ecs-hatch-pop-kit/015568ecs01~a/
